Input level control 21 22 UB-1K BODYPACK MICROPHONE TRANSMITTER 17. Setting up the Transmitter The UH-1K requires 2x AA size batteries to operate. To install the batteries onto the Battery Holder (30), press the "OPEN" side on the Battery Lid (29) and slide as indicated by the arrow to open the Battery Lid (29), exposing the battery holder. Insert 2 fresh AA batteries according to the correct polarity as indicated on the transmitter body. Cover the Battery Lid (29) and press on the "CLOSE" side slide as indicated by the arrow to lock the battery door securely. Fresh Alkaline batteries can last for up to 8-10 hour of operation, but in order to ensure optimum performance, it is recommended that the batteries be replaced after 6-8 hours of use. 18. Powering the Transmitter ON/OFF To turn transmitter on, press and hold the Power/Mute Button (32) for more than 2 seconds. Both LEDs IR/Audio Mute (34) and Battery Strength Indicator (33) will light up. After 20 seconds the green IR LED (34) will automatically turn off. If the audio is muted (see Section 20 below) the LED will stay lit and change to red till the audio mute is turned off (and audio signal is 9 UB-1K BODYPACK MICROPHONE TRANSMITTER back on). The Battery Level LED (33) should stay fully lit green indicating usable battery strength. This LED turns red if the batteries are low and the batteries should be replaced with new ones. To preserve battery life, turn the transmitter off when not in use.
